PURPOSE: To obtain a solution containing a macromolecular solute at an accurately controlled concentration by filtrating and condensing the solution through a semipermeable membrane.
CONSTITUTION: Two facing covers 2 are stuck to an enclosure 1 and a pair of condensing units in arranged in the enclosure 1. Each condensing unit is provided with a chamber 9, an absorbent layer 7, and an elastic layer 8 and one wall surface of the chamber 9 is constituted of the rear surface of one cover 2. The other wall surface is constituted of a semipermeable film 6 having permeability to the solvent of a sample solution, but no permeability to a macromolecular solute, and the horizontal wall of the chamber 9 constitutes a projecting section 4. A frame 10 which is in close contact with the film 6 forms areas 10A, 10B, 10C, and 10D having permeability to the sample solution and the absorbent layer 7 keeps the solvent passed through the film 6. The elastic layer 8 presses the layer 7 against the film 6. Both units are separated from each other by a wall 11 and simultaneously but separately condense the sample solution. The sample solution is introduced from ports 3A and 3B and the condensed solution can be taken out with a pipette.
